Ubisoft names co-CEOs for new subsidiary to lead Assassin’s Creed, Far Cry franchises

Ubisoft has appointed Christophe Derennes and Charlie Guillemot as co-CEOs of its new subsidiary, marking a significant step in the company’s strategy to transform three of its most valuable franchises into billion-euro properties.
The subsidiary, first announced in March, will focus exclusively on developing Assassin’s Creed, Rainbow Six, and Far Cry into “evergreen, multi-platform game ecosystems” with backing from strategic partner Tencent. The Chinese tech giant’s investment is expected to complete by the end of 2025, pending regulatory approval.
